These are density-based examples. Your final estimate depends on the finished packaged dimensions, total weight, stackability, fragility, value, and handling requirements for the bolt shipment.

Freight classes shown on this page are density-based estimates for shipment planning. Actual classification may also depend on value, handling requirements, liability, stowability, dimensions, and other commodity-specific factors. Confirm the final freight class with your carrier, broker, or official NMFC resources before shipping.
